Animal testing, also known as animal experimentation or vivisection, has long been a controversial topic with ethical implications. It involves the use of animals in scientific research to gain insights into human biology, develop new drugs and treatments, and ensure the safety of consumer products. However, the practice raises important ethical considerations that need to be carefully examined and addressed.
One of the primary ethical concerns surrounding animal testing is the welfare and suffering of animals. Animals used in research can experience pain, distress, and even death as a result of experimental procedures. This raises questions about the ethical justifications for causing harm to sentient beings and whether the potential benefits outweigh the animal welfare considerations.
The principle of animal rights comes into play when discussing the ethics of animal testing. Animal rights advocates argue that animals possess intrinsic value and have the right to live free from unnecessary harm and exploitation. They contend that the use of animals in research is a violation of these rights and advocate for alternative methods that can provide accurate scientific results without the use of animals.
The concept of the “three Rs” (replacement, reduction, and refinement) has gained prominence in addressing the ethical concerns of animal testing. Replacement refers to the exploration and utilization of alternative methods that do not involve the use of animals. Reduction focuses on minimizing the number of animals used in experiments to the absolute minimum required for valid scientific results. Refinement involves improving experimental procedures to minimize pain and distress for the animals involved.
The reliability and validity of animal models are also ethical considerations. Animal testing assumes that animals can serve as accurate predictors of human responses, but the extrapolation of data from animals to humans is not always straightforward. Differences in biology, metabolism, and genetics between species can limit the applicability of animal data to human conditions. Ethical questions arise when animal testing is relied upon as the sole basis for human health and safety decisions.
The ethical implications of animal testing extend to the development and use of alternative methods. Efforts are being made to develop and promote alternative approaches, such as in vitro (test tube) studies, computer simulations, and tissue engineering, which can provide valuable insights without the use of animals. However, ensuring the effectiveness, reliability, and regulatory acceptance of these alternatives presents its own set of challenges.
Balancing the potential benefits of animal testing with the ethical considerations is a complex task. On one hand, animal testing has contributed to significant advancements in medical treatments and understanding of diseases. Many life-saving drugs and therapies have been developed through animal research. On the other hand, advancements in technology and scientific knowledge open up opportunities to explore alternative methods that could potentially replace or reduce the reliance on animal testing.
Transparency and public engagement are important aspects of addressing the ethical considerations of animal testing. Informed public discourse, involving stakeholders such as scientists, ethicists, policymakers, and animal welfare organizations, can help foster a better understanding of the ethical challenges and promote the development of responsible research practices.
Legislation and regulation play a crucial role in governing animal testing practices and ensuring ethical standards are upheld. Countries have established laws and guidelines that govern the care and use of animals in research. Ethical review boards and animal welfare committees are often involved in evaluating the ethical justifications and potential benefits of proposed experiments.
In conclusion, the ethical considerations of animal testing in scientific research are complex and multifaceted. Balancing the pursuit of scientific knowledge and medical advancements with the welfare of animals requires ongoing evaluation, refinement of practices, and exploration of alternative methods. Striving for the replacement, reduction, and refinement of animal testing, along with public engagement and ethical guidelines, can contribute to a more responsible and compassionate approach to scientific research.
